MODULAR GARMENT FOR A WEARABLE MEDICAL DEVICE

    Abstract: An ergonomic and unobtrusive cardiac monitoring and treatment device for continuous wear includes a band configured to be worn about a thoracic region of a patient within a T1 thoracic vertebra region to a T12 thoracic vertebra region. The band includes a vertical span of between 1 to 15 centimeters along at least 50 percent of a length of the band and is configured to be immobilized relative to a skin surface of the thoracic region by exerting one or more compression forces. The device also includes electrodes and associated circuitry disposed about the band, one or more sensor ports for receiving one or more physiological sensors separate from ECG sensing electrodes, and a controller. The controller includes an ingress-protected housing and a processor configured to analyze ECG information of the patient, detect one or more treatable arrhythmias based on the ECG information, and cause delivery of electrotherapy.

    Processing impedance signals for breath detection

    Abstract: An apparatus for assisting in providing patient ventilations includes electrodes configured to provide airflow activities signals, chest compression sensors configured to provide chest displacement signals due to chest compressions, a processor and a memory configured to receive the airflow activities and chest displacement signals, identify a presence of chest compressions based on the chest displacement signals, subsequently confirm an absence of chest compressions applied to the patient based on the chest displacement signals, adjust signal processing parameters for the airflow activities signals in response to the confirmed absence of chest compressions, and process the airflow activities signals using the adjusted signal processing parameters to determine feedback for providing the patient ventilations in the absence of chest compressions, and an output device coupled to the processor and the memory and configured to provide the ventilation feedback.

    ACTIVE COMPRESSION-DECOMPRESSION DEVICE INTEGRATION

    Abstract: A system is provided for resuscitative therapy to a patient by delivering active chest compression decompressions. The system may include an ACD device configured to be coupled to the patient's chest and constructed for a rescuer to press and pull on the ACD device to administer active compression decompression therapy. Additionally, the ACD device may include at least one sensor for sensing at least one active compression decompression parameter, processing circuitry configured to process the at least one active compression decompression parameter and provide an output based on the at least one parameter, a first communication circuit configured to transfer data related to the processed output of the at least one parameter, and a second communication circuit capable of being removably coupled to either the electrode assembly or the ACD device.

    MOBILE MONITORING AND PATIENT MANAGEMENT SYSTEM

    Abstract: A patient management system for providing patient queues of patient reports to users includes communications circuitry configured to receive first physiological information from monitoring medical devices being worn by a first plurality of patients and receive second physiological information from therapeutic medical devices being worn by a second plurality of patients. Each of the monitoring medical devices is configured to sense one or more predetermined physiological parameters of its respective patient. Each of the therapeutic medical devices is configured to monitor its respective patient for a predetermined physiological condition and provide a treatment. The patient management system also includes at least one processor configured to prepare a plurality of monitoring patient reports, prepare a plurality of therapeutic patient reports, generate a patient queue based on the pluralities of monitoring and therapeutic patient reports, and provide the patient queue to an end user computing device via the communications circuitry.

    Rescue time tracker

    Abstract: A medical device system for tracking medical event times during patient treatment includes a medical device comprising a defibrillator/monitor and a mobile computing device including a communication interface configured to communicatively couple the mobile computing device to the medical device and receive patient data comprising medical information and time information comprising one or more medical events associated with the patient data, a display configured to provide a graphical user interface that provides the patient data and the time information, and one or more processors and associated memory, the one or more processors configured to control the graphical user interface to provide the patient data and the time information.

    RESPIRATORY DISTRESS MANAGEMENT APPARATUS, SYSTEM AND METHOD

    Abstract: Respiratory distress apparatuses, systems and methods are described. An example respiratory distress management device includes a housing, and further has a mechanical ventilation apparatus and a controller within the housing. The controller may include a processor and a memory. The controller may be configured to determine whether, at a particular time, a fault mode condition exists. If a fault mode condition is determined not to exist, then the controller may be configured to enable control of the mechanical ventilation apparatus of the respiratory distress management device by a source in delivering mechanical ventilation to a patient, via signals received by the controller from the source. If a fault mode condition is determined to exist, then the controller may be configured to control the mechanical ventilation apparatus of the respiratory distress management device in delivering mechanical ventilation to the patient.

    EMS DECISION SUPPORT INTERFACE, EVENT HISTORY, AND RELATED TOOLS

    Abstract: A system for medical data review and playback includes a medical device including sensors configured to collect patient data during a medical event, a display screen, and a communication port configured to access a WAN, a processor configured to receive the patient data, control the display screen to display the patient data during the medical event, communicably couple to a database, and provide the patient data to the database, and a playback interface display configured to access the database, and provide the playback interface configured to permit sequential playback of the patient data and including visual representations of the patient data displayed at the medical device display screen, and a visual timeline representing times during the medical event and including a timeline indicator configured to move the sequential playback of the patient data to a user-selected time during the medical event in response to user input.
